Maple and Bella are litter mates. They were found as strays in rural Missouri with another male puppy. They have gone unclaimed during their stray hold so we don’t know what their life was like before they came to MOGS.

 

TEMPERAMENT / BEHAVIOR
They are currently both together in a foster home with 3 adult German Shepherds. They are typical curious and playful pups, who like to test boundaries. They are both very sweet and will capture your heart when they cuddle up to you. As with any puppy, they need constant and vigilant supervision as they are learning proper behaviors so they can be the best pups they can be. They are both very smart and learn quick as long as they are supervised and corrected when needed. Puppies want and need their people to teach and guide them!

 

TRAINING
They are both such smart girls! They learn so quickly, and are doing excellent at potty training and learning manners. They are currently working on potty training, not jumping on people, sitting to be let out of their kennels, sitting for food, and walking on a leash. They do great in their kennel! They go right in, and will sleep quietly all night for 8 hours with no accidents. They even go in their kennels on their own when they get tired of all the playing. They are currently kenneled separately next to each other and one of their foster sisters.

 

OTHER ANIMALS
Bella and Maple play hard together like typical pups. They occasionally get a little too rough but break up quickly when they are addressed. They have 3 older GSD foster sisters who they do fine with. The pups prefer to play with each other and their toys and don’t bother the older dogs very often. They are very curious about them and will try to “cuddle” with them at times. When the larger dogs bark and play, the pups can get a little nervous and scared, as if they can’t figure them out. They have briefly been around a cat and were interested but not aggressive.

 

PEOPLE
Both girls bonded to their foster parents quickly but are nervous meeting new people. They really want to meet them but are just a little scared! When new people visit, as long as they sit, let the girls come to them and have treats ready, the pups are letting the new person pet them in a few minutes. Their new families will need to keep socializing them so they continue to learn that people are ok. So far, they have met male and female adults and children. They don't seem to shy away from anyone in particular.



MAPLE'S ADOPTION FEE:   $400
This fee covers only part of what we spend to vet, board and rehab the dogs we save.  On average we spend over $450 on each dog.  We made a decision to keep our adoption fee at the 2005 level even though vet prices have doubled and tripled since then.  We are constantly fundraising to cover the deficit.  At minimum, your adoption fee includes the dog's spay/neuter, heartworm test, heartworm treatment if needed, rabies shot, distemper/parvo shot, bordatella shot, deworming, monthly heartworm and flea preventives, and microchip.  In many cases it also includes surgery and various types of vet treatment for standard issues such as hot spots, ear infections and so on.

Are you sure you're up to having a GSD?  They're not for everyone.  They take a lot of time, effort, training.  They shed year round.  They're big.  They scare lots of people.  They "mouth" and herd.  They're usually strong-willed and stubborn.  You have to have references and a home visit.  If you're not willing or able to deal with any of this, please don't waste your time or ours applying.  
  3. Will the dog be an inside family pet? We do not adopt to outdoor-only homes. All dogs must be indoor dogs.
  4. Do you leave your dog outdoors when you're not home?   We do not adopt to homes that leave their animals outside when they're gone.  You must put your dogs indoors when you're gone.  A 3 yr old adopted MOGS dog died when the owners went to run errands, left her outdoors, the gate was somehow opened, and she was hit by a car.  Tragic and 100% preventable. Even privacy fences get broken into.  Gates are opened.  Thieves steal dogs. Never leave your dog outdoors when you're not home!!
